Description

In this side-scrolling bomber, you pilot the good ship Hercules, flying over Land Rovers which are firing missiles at you. Your mission is to bomb all the Land Rovers into oblivion so you can get on to the presumably easier part of attacking a small town. Fortunately for the town, there is an endless line of Land Rovers defending against your three ships. You're never going to see that town.

The Land Rovers are stationary and come five at a time, firing well-aimed missiles. You maneuver your ship over them -- up and down, slow and fast -- dropping just one bomb at a time. Your ship keeps cycling overhead until all five Rovers are gone; misses only use up fuel, which is limited, counts for points, and ticks downward more quickly with each round.

There's no bonus ships, difficulty levels, armor, or power-ups: just four arrow keys and three strikes until you're out. True to the genre, the game does give you an instruction screen and a score.
